Drew Coco was the King of the Mountain and Vonda Garcia was the Queen of the Mountain in the 37th annual Big Mountain Run Saturday.

Coco finished the run with a time of 36:15 earning the fastest time for men, and Garcia finished with a time of 49:20.

Prince was Jacob Henson, 15, with a time of 41:12 and Princess was Madelaine Jellison, 14, with a time of 47:26.

The top dog was Rooster with a time of 72:38.

The race begins at the Danny On Trailhead in the Upper Village near the Hellroaring Saloon and participants run or hike 3.8 miles with 2,434 feet in elevation gain to the summit of Big Mountain.

The annual race is a fundraiser for the Glacier Nordic Club.

For Birthday Club winners, men must beat their age and women must beat their age plus 10 minutes. Birthday Club winners included, Franz Ingelfinger, Jim Cabe, Vonda Garcia, Cynthia Ingelfinger, Casey Deitz, Eric Vardell, Bruce Clements, Stacey Bent, Mike Muldown, Julie Engler and Jodee Yachechak.
